confirmation of z3950 search & import working
Hi group, I can now confirm that z3950 search & import IS working here on my setup of: Fedora Core 1 (perl and mysql version not modified from the distro version) Tt then sounds very promissing for the upcoming 2.0 (clear) version. But two questions arise: 1. Does admin (or whoever performs cataloging) need to manually export PERL5LIB and KOHA_CONF env variables as root? Can't a setup script do it for a site (installation of koha?) 2. In help pane it says that once a record is found in the reservoir (breeding farm) while a search on a title or isbn is performed, and if an item (real copy) is added to koha system then that biblio will also be removed from the reservoir ...? It doesn't happen here on my system. A second search on same isbn or title continues to find a biblio in the reservoir. Any suggestions? Benedict
